Since 1994 childhood vaccines have prevented: 508M cases of illnesses 32M hospitalizations 1.3M deaths Every $1 spent on childhood vaccines, the US has saved $10.90, totaling $2.7 trillion in societal savings. Yet, tomorrow ACIP will consider changing the schedule based on no science or data.

This Day in Labor History: June 10, 1963. President John F. Kennedy signed the Equal Pay Act. This was the most important piece of legislation on the long road to pay equality by gender, a goal that we have still not reached!!
